
Meg Colleton BSN, RN, CPHQ
Nurse Researcher, Press Ganey Associates LLC
Meg Colleton is a registered nurse and certified professional in healthcare quality with a clinical background in neonatal intensive care and women's health. She earned a bachelor of arts degree from the University of Notre Dame and a bachelor of science degree in nursing from Loyola University Chicago. For the past seven years, she has worked as a clinical advisor and nurse researcher with the National Database of Nursing Quality Indicators at Press Ganey Associates, supporting clients in advancing clinical quality, fostering workplace safety, improving the nursing work environment, conducting research, and developing measures of clinical quality across multiple care settings.
